The phrase “how to cook apples for baby” describes the various methods employed to prepare apples in a manner suitable for infant consumption. These methods aim to soften the fruit, making it easily digestible and reducing the risk of choking hazards. This often involves steaming, baking, or boiling the apples until tender, followed by pureeing or mashing them to the appropriate consistency. For example, one might peel, core, and steam apple slices until soft, then blend them into a smooth puree.

Preparing apples properly for infants is important for several reasons. It introduces them to the taste and texture of solid food, aiding in the development of their palate. Apples are a good source of vitamins and fiber, contributing to a healthy diet. Historically, cooked apples have been a traditional first food for babies due to their readily availability, mild flavor, and easy preparation. The softening process also addresses the immature digestive systems of young children.

The process of preparing field peas for consumption typically involves several key steps designed to enhance flavor and ensure proper texture. Initial preparation often includes rinsing and soaking the dried peas, followed by simmering them in water or broth until they reach the desired tenderness. Some recipes incorporate ingredients such as salt pork, ham hocks, or various seasonings to augment the final taste profile. This culinary procedure is fundamental to Southern cuisine. For instance, a common method entails slow-cooking the peas with smoked meat to impart a savory depth.

Properly prepared field peas provide nutritional benefits and hold cultural significance in many regions. They are a source of plant-based protein, fiber, and essential vitamins and minerals. Historically, these legumes have been a staple food, particularly in the Southern United States, where they are often associated with traditions of resourcefulness and culinary heritage. Dishes featuring them can be found at community gatherings and family meals, reflecting their enduring place in local gastronomy.
